MEMO — Retirement of the Fennick Range

To heads of department: following the portfolio review, the Fennick product line will be retired over the next three quarters. Production at the Caldmere site winds down in stages, with final shipments by end of Q2 next year. Existing support contracts will be honoured through their terms. Affected staff will be offered transfers to the Orelia line where possible. Customer communications are being drafted centrally — do not pre-announce. Successor plans are outlined in the confidential note below.

board note of fahif-yahog: Gross margin on Wenath came in at 10 percent against a plan of 5 percent. Only 3 of the 100 pilot accounts renewed Wenath, so a churn review is set for July 15.

## Support

This section covers the stale-cache bug documented in postmortem PM-14. The Lanternfish cache layer served expired pricing entries for six hours because the invalidation worker silently crashed. The fix in this PR adds a heartbeat check and hard TTL enforcement; reviewers should confirm both paths are tested. Known gaps: the warmup script still bypasses TTL, tracked separately. Questions about the postmortem itself go to the Corvid platform team. If review questions remain, contact the cache maintainers at the address below.

escalation mailbox, badug-tawip: ulaath@nelvroforge.example

# Environment Variables: Report Export Timezones

The Quillbarn export service converts all timestamps using `EXPORT_TZ`, which must be a valid IANA zone name; defaults to UTC if unset. Reviewers should verify that `TZ_FALLBACK_STRICT=true` in production, since silent fallbacks caused the Marlow incident. The service also signs exported files, and the signing secret belongs on the following line of the env file.

vault entry, hahaf-tafog: VAULT_KEY3=38a

[ ] Fleet fuel-usage report verification. Before tagging the Hauloway release, run the fuel-usage report against the staging fleet dataset (Brenmark depot, 40 vehicles). Confirm totals match the manual reconciliation sheet within 0.5%. Check that idle-time fuel is excluded when the toggle is off. If any vehicle shows negative consumption, stop and escalate — do not ship. New folks: the report job logs are under the fleet-reports namespace. Sign off here and paste confirmation in the channel. The release build token follows.

session token of tajef-bageg = htk21_5d90d574934f3ccae6437